implement missing SCEVDivision case
authorSebastian Pop <spop@codeaurora.org>
Thu, 29 May 2014 19:44:09 +0000 (19:44 +0000)
committerSebastian Pop <spop@codeaurora.org>
Thu, 29 May 2014 19:44:09 +0000 (19:44 +0000)
commit20b6ed3c9c58104d76c523bdd7a5b7b6c1feb729
treee4e7b3c2065e257855c252ab4d66b258c642f26b
parente741924230245250448a41d54adc7238e0eac716
implement missing SCEVDivision case

without this case we would end on an infinite recursion: the remainder is zero,
so Numerator - Remainder is equal to Numerator and so we would recursively ask
for the division of Numerator by Denominator.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@209838 91177308-0d34-0410-b5e6-96231b3b80d8
lib/Analysis/ScalarEvolution.cpp